4 Reasons to Earn Your Associate’s Degree in MRI

Learn About MRI Safety, New Techniques, Human Brain Mapping, & More

An associate’s degree in MRI technology is one of the most important qualifications for aspiring MRI technologists. Without it, most clinics and healthcare facilities in the United States won’t consider candidates for employment. This degree not only demonstrates your foundational knowledge but also opens the door to a rewarding career in medical imaging.

While earning an associate’s degree in MRI technology might seem straightforward, it can be challenging for individuals juggling multiple jobs or other responsibilities. Fortunately, Pulse Radiology Institute offers a flexible and accessible solution through its online programs. Here are four compelling reasons why an online associate’s degree in MRI technology is a great option for busy students.

Online Courses Offer Unmatched Flexibility

Traditional in-person courses come with fixed schedules, which can be difficult to manage if you’re working a full-time job or handling other commitments. Online courses, however, allow students to learn at their own pace. With Pulse Radiology Institute, you can access lessons anytime, anywhere, on any electronic device. Whether you have a free moment during your lunch break or in the evening after work, you can dive into your studies effortlessly. This flexibility ensures that earning your associate’s degree in MRI technology fits seamlessly into your busy lifestyle.

Flexible Clinical Training Opportunities

Clinical training is a critical component of any program for an associate’s degree in MRI technology, as it bridges the gap between theoretical learning and real-world application. Pulse Radiology Institute simplifies this process by partnering with over 100 clinics across the United States. Students can easily schedule training sessions at affiliated clinics near their location. Each session is guided by a clinical coordinator who ensures the training runs smoothly and effectively, giving students hands-on experience operating MRI machines and interacting with patients.

Accreditation Ensures the Degree’s Validity

Pulse Radiology Institute’s online associate’s degree in MRI technology is accredited by ARMRIT, the leading authority in MRI education in the United States. This accreditation guarantees that the program meets the highest industry standards, and your degree will be recognized and respected by employers. Students can confidently pursue job opportunities, knowing their qualifications are as valid as those from traditional, in-person programs.
